Self drive Day boats can be hired by you to explore the River Waveney on the Broads National park, you skipper your “boat for the day”. The boat is available for your use from 9.15am - 4.30pm, and you can choose to use it for as much or as little of this time as you choose to. Parking on site is provided with your own named space. Buoyancy aids and all fuel is included, the party leader needs to be  at least 18. Whoever captains the boat must stay under the legal limit for driving and no alcohol is to be consumed or taken on our boats.   All our boats are non smoking and non vaping.  We offer your boat for a day hire only, booked in advance online.

We enjoy a drink and we love boats but the two don’t mix. In order to bring the river to life safely and to ensure you have a positive experience, we require that alcohol will not be taken or consumed on board the boats.

If you intend to arrive on foot, then we will be taking a deposit of £250 for the boat, on one card, which will be returned within five working days when the boat is returned safely and the driver is under the legal limit.

Pedal Boat

Like boats? Like bikes? want to do something unique and quirky and have a little adventure of your own on the water? why not try the Pedal Boat, a totally different and extremely relaxing way to explore the river and get close to wildlife.
You and your companion will face each other, cycling towards each other to go forwards, and away from each other to reverse. It is a unique and gentle way to explore the river, and don’t forget to wave at the river bank dwellers as they spot the flags.

Fishing is only permitted from day boats during the fishing season, and when the engine is not running, this is to ensure the line does not get caught in the propeller and following national park guidelines.  There is no room for fishing gear on the pedal boat, although it is perfect for wildlife photographers.
